Slow motion using longitudinal recording and forward/reverse tape transportation

1. Apparatus for use in providing a slow motion display of scene information recorded on a magnetic recording medium in the form of a plurality of frames of time sequential scene information, the magnetic recording medium being transportable in a reverse direction and in a forward direction, said apparatus comprising:

  • (a) means for playing back information from said magnetic recording medium upon the transportation of said magnetic recording medium in the forward direction;

    (b) means for repeatedly transporting said magnetic recording medium in accordance with a transport cycle wherein said magnetic recording medium is transported in the reverse direction and then in the forward direction to effect playback of a frame of scene information during each transport cycle;

    (c) a frame storage device cooperative with said means for playing back information for storing a frame of scene information as it is played back from said magnetic recording medium by said playback means; and

    (d) means cooperative with said frame storage device for continuously reading out information stored by said frame storage device,said transport means including means for selectively transporting said magnetic recording medium during each transport cycle a distance DF in the reverse direction and a distance DF +DT in the forward direction, where DT is nominally equal to the distance said magnetic recording medium must be transported in the forward direction to effect playback of a single frame of scene information, thereby resulting in playback of frames of scene information in slowed chronological order that depends on the repetition rate of said means for repeatedly transporting said magnetic recording medium.
